Dr. Blacks hours:

by appointment only

Dr. Simon Brown

Dr. Simon Brown

Dr. David Lewis

Dr. David Lewis

Dr. Miriam Buchstein

Dr. Miriam Buchstein


Dr. Brian Zidel

Dr. Brian Zidel

Dr. Kirit Thakkar

Dr. Kirit Thakkar

Dr. Karen Marshall

Dr. Karen Marshall

Dr. Jaspreet Perera

Dr. Jaspreet Perera


Dr. Ruwan Perera

Dr. Ruwan Perera

Dr. Joseph Bertucci

Dr. Joseph Bertucci

Dr. Mehvish Jawaid

Dr. Mehvish Jawaid

Dr. Shawn Dhaliwal

Dr. Shawn Dhaliwal